【问题标题】:vtkSelectVisiblePoints filter output has 0 pointsvtkSelectVisiblePoints 过滤器输出有 0 个点

【问题描述】:

我正在尝试获取仅包含 3D 模型可见部分的 polyData。 在这种情况下,我通过 vtkSelectVisiblePoints 过滤器传递原始数据。

我正在使用模拟渲染器、映射器和演员,因为我想在显示可见点之前对其进行后处理。

但是,由于某种原因,vtkSelectVisiblePoints 过滤器的输出包含“0”点……

使用以下示例: http://www.vtk.org/Wiki/VTK/Examples/Cxx/PolyData/SelectVisiblePoints

我想出了以下代码:

  // Render window and interactor
  vtkSmartPointer<vtkRenderWindow> renderWindow =
    vtkSmartPointer<vtkRenderWindow>::New();
  renderWindow->SetSize(800, 800);

  vtkSmartPointer<vtkRenderWindowInteractor> renderWindowInteractor =
    vtkSmartPointer<vtkRenderWindowInteractor>::New();

  renderWindowInteractor->SetRenderWindow(renderWindow);


  // Mock renderer, mapper and actor
  vtkSmartPointer<vtkRenderer> mockRenderer =
    vtkSmartPointer<vtkRenderer>::New();

  renderWindow->AddRenderer(mockRenderer);

  vtkSmartPointer<vtkPolyDataMapper> mockMapper =
    vtkSmartPointer<vtkPolyDataMapper>::New();
  mockMapper->SetInput(reader->GetOutput());

  vtkSmartPointer<vtkActor> mockActor = vtkSmartPointer<vtkActor>::New();
  mockActor->SetMapper(mockMapper);
  mockRenderer->AddActor(mockActor);

  // Set camera to the correct position
  mockRenderer->GetActiveCamera()->SetPosition(0, -1, 0);
  mockRenderer->GetActiveCamera()->SetFocalPoint(0, 0, 0);
  mockRenderer->GetActiveCamera()->SetViewUp(0, 1, 0);
  mockRenderer->ResetCamera();

  vtkSmartPointer<vtkSelectVisiblePoints> selectVisiblePoints =
    vtkSmartPointer<vtkSelectVisiblePoints>::New();
  selectVisiblePoints->SetInput(reader->GetOutput());
  selectVisiblePoints->SetRenderer(mockRenderer);
  selectVisiblePoints->Update();

  std::cout << "Visible nr of points = " << selectVisiblePoints->GetOutput()->GetNumberOfPoints() << std::endl;

  renderWindow->RemoveRenderer(mockRenderer);

… 打印 0。

但是,如果我调用renderWindow-&gt;Render(),模型的可见部分会正确显示...

我错过了什么吗...?

  • 问题在于,为了使点可见,您需要先渲染它们。
  • 确实,加上renderWindow->Render();然后选择VisiblePoints->Update(); ,点数正确显示。请发表您的评论作为回复,以便我接受。

【解决方案1】:

答案就在那里,在documentation of the filter

警告您必须仔细同步此过滤器的执行。 filter指的是一个renderer,每次render时都会修改 发生。因此,过滤器总是过时的,并且总是 执行。您可能需要执行两次渲染通道

如果我添加 //new 行,它会按预期工作,就像 Arnas 在他的评论中所建议的那样:

  vtkSmartPointer<vtkSelectVisiblePoints> selectVisiblePoints = 
    vtkSmartPointer<vtkSelectVisiblePoints>::New();
  selectVisiblePoints->SetInput(originalData);
  selectVisiblePoints->SetRenderer(renderer);
  selectVisiblePoints->Update();

  renderWindow->Render(); // new
  selectVisiblePoints->Update(); // new

  std::cout << "Visible nr of points = " << selectVisiblePoints->GetOutput()->GetNumberOfPoints() << std::endl;
